Tennessee State University is a public institution in Nashville with particular strength in health sciences and business. With an average SAT of 1017, the school attracts a broad applicant pool.
A mid-sized campus of 6.5K undergraduates with a 13:1 student-faculty ratio. The urban location puts students at the center of city life.
33% of students graduate within four years, and graduates earn a median of $42,730 a decade after enrollment. Net price after aid averages $10,026.

History & Fun Facts
- •History The university was established as the Tennessee Agricultural Industrial State Normal School for Negroes in 1912.
- •It changed its name to Tennessee Agricultural Industrial State Normal College in 1925.
- •In 1941, the Tennessee General Assembly directed the Board of Education to upgrade the educational program of the college.
